To display the word count in the Status Bar, go to the Review tab and click the arrow next to Word Count.įrom there, check the box for Show Word Count. This displays a small pop-up window showing the number of words, characters, and paragraphs. To do this, go to the Review tab and click Word Count on the left side. You can also check it manually when needed. If you’re using Word on the web, you can also display the word count in the Status Bar. If you click the word count in the Status Bar, you’ll see the same counts as shown above for words, pages, characters, paragraphs, and lines. Notice that you can also include the Character Count (with spaces) option in your Status Bar if you like. You should then see the count on the left side. Start by right-clicking the Status Bar and selecting Word Count to place a checkmark next to it.

To do this, press Word Count on the Review tab on Windows or Tools > Word Count from the menu bar on Mac.Īlong with the number of words, you’ll also see the number of pages, characters, paragraphs, and lines. You can open the Word Count dialog box or view a running count in your Status Bar. If you use Microsoft Word on Windows or Mac, you’ll see the same options for viewing an up-to-date word count in your document.

In addition, highlighting text will show you the word count of the selection as a proportion of the overall document (e.g., 105 of 649 words). As a default, in the bottom left of the status bar you will see a page count and overall word count for the document you’re working on.     This will close the pop-up and return you to the document.Īlternatively, PC users can access the word count in Microsoft Word using the shortcut Ctrl + Shift + G. When you’re done, simply click “Close” or “OK” (depending on your version of Word). Viewing the word count in Microsoft Word. There is also an option for whether to include footnotes and endnotes in the word count. This will open a pop-up where you can see the number of pages, words, characters, paragraphs, and lines in the document (or a passage of text selected with the cursor).
